The Meaning of ‘Boo’

When a girl calls you “boo,” it can mean a variety of things depending on the context and the relationship between you and the girl. Here are some possible meanings:

  • Term of Endearment: “Boo” is often used as a term of endearment, similar to “babe,” “sweetie,” or “honey.” It can be a way of showing affection and closeness, especially in romantic relationships.

  • Attraction: If a girl calls you “boo” and seems flirty or playful, it could be a sign that she is attracted to you. This doesn’t necessarily mean she wants a relationship, but it could be a hint that she’s interested in getting to know you better.

  • Friendship: Sometimes “boo” is used between friends as a casual, affectionate nickname. If you and the girl are close friends, it could simply be a way of expressing your friendship.

  • Regional or Cultural Differences: The meaning of “boo” can vary depending on the region or culture. For example, in African American Vernacular English, “boo” can be used as a term of endearment or as a way of addressing someone you don’t know well. In other cultures, “boo” might not be used at all.

It’s important to remember that context and tone of voice are key when interpreting what “boo” means. If you’re unsure about the girl’s intentions, it’s always best to ask for clarification rather than making assumptions.

Contextual Interpretations

When a girl calls you “boo,” it can be interpreted in different ways depending on the context. Here are some factors that can affect the meaning of this term:

Cultural Influence

The cultural background of the person using the term can influence its meaning. For instance, in some African American communities, “boo” is a term of endearment that can be used between friends, family members, or romantic partners. Similarly, in some Caribbean cultures, “boo” can mean “boyfriend” or “girlfriend.” Therefore, it’s important to consider the cultural context when interpreting the meaning of this term.

Level of Intimacy

The level of intimacy between the person using the term and the recipient can also affect its meaning. If a girl calls you “boo” but you’re not close friends or in a romantic relationship, it could be a sign that she’s interested in getting to know you better. On the other hand, if you’re already in a romantic relationship, “boo” can be a term of endearment that expresses affection and closeness.

Frequency of Use

The frequency with which the term is used can also give you clues about its meaning. If a girl uses “boo” sparingly, it could be a sign that she’s using it intentionally to convey a specific message. For example, she might use it to flirt with you or to express her romantic interest. However, if she uses “boo” casually and frequently, it might just be a part of her everyday vocabulary and not carry any special meaning.

In summary, the meaning of “boo” can vary widely depending on the context in which it’s used. By taking into account factors such as cultural background, level of intimacy, and frequency of use, you can better interpret the message that a girl is trying to convey when she calls you “boo.”
